simplify fully
2√3 x 3√8​

Answer: 12√6

Step-by-step explanation:

Given the expression;

2√3 * 3√√8

= (2*3) * (√3*√8)

= 6 * (√24)

= 6 * √4*6

= 6 * (2√6)

= (6*2)√6

= 12√6

Therefore, the simplified form of the expression is 12√6.
